Output bb24e3cc01390063f0337d0e054d974eec38750a4745e13e5df60a10fc7a5ab9:0

value
8582785058
script pubkey
OP_0 OP_PUSHBYTES_20 37d519e2a44b261b2724a36e2338292284601158
address
tb1qxl23nc4yfvnpkfey5dhzxwpfy2zxqy2cna4rsj
transaction
bb24e3cc01390063f0337d0e054d974eec38750a4745e13e5df60a10fc7a5ab9
confirmations
78196
spent
true